The next morning was my first day of suspension. Despite being upset that I was suspended for the first time, I was looking forward to the time off before I went back on Friday. 

Walking into the kitchen, I was surprised to see Michael and Steve sitting on the bar talking to James and Tessa who we’re making breakfast. The door shut behind me, announcing my arrival to the others. James said good morning followed by Michael and Steve. Tessa walked over to me and gave me a hug instead, to which I gladly returned. She quickly returned to her spot next to James who was struggling to maintain all of the pots at once. 

“W-what are you guys doing here? And aren’t you supposed to be at work?” I asked pointing to James. Michael shook his head as if he were disappointed. 

“Wow, I thought you’d be happy to see us again.” 

“I didn’t mean it that way! I was just surprised to see you here! I’m sorry!” Everyone laughed, but I could see a hint of concern behind James’ eyes.  

“I know, I know. I’m just playing.” 

“We’re part of your surprise,” Steve added. 

“James already told us what happened, it looks like she got you good, huh?” asked Michael. 

“What?” He got up and walked over to me grabbing my chin and tilting it forward. It sent flashbacks of my father through my head and I immediately jumped back my guard up. I saw James turn around in a flash his face pulled into a frown, but before he could do anything I spoke. 

“Sorry, you caught me by surprise.” 

“Ah, that’s alright. I should be the one apologizing. But you have a giant bruise on your cheek.”  I placed my hand and on my cheek and sure enough right where Beverley had punched me was sore. 

“I didn’t even notice.” 

“Did you get her back?” Steve asked with a laugh. 

“Don’t encourage her!” Tessa laughed, lightly swatting him. 

Finally, I took a seat next to Steve at the bar and Michael went back to his seat. “So are you guys gonna tell me what this surprise is?” 

“Do you know what the meaning of surprise is Sera?” James asked. It was really starting to bug me. I hated surprises. Instead of giving him the glare he deserved, I turned my head to the side like I was confused. 

“No, I don’t actually. What is a surprise?” 

Immediately James, Michael, and Steve all looked shocked. Tessa laughed and slapped James on the back of the head. “You guys are all idiots. It was obviously sarcasm. Now stop fooling around and finish the bacon, James. Michael and Steve set the table.” 

James turned back to the stove while Michael and Steve stood up out of their seats and headed to the cabinets. “Yes, ma’am,” they said in unison causing me to laugh. 

“You should do that more often.” 

“I know,” she laughed. 

An hour later we were done with breakfast, ready, and in the car. And I still didn’t know where we were going. I just wanted to scream at them until they told me and it's obvious that they all thought it was funny. I could see them trying to hide their snickers behind their hands, but they’re weren’t doing a very good job at it. 

Right before I was going to explode from anger and nerves, the car stopped. Looking around I was met with the sight of something I hadn’t been to in years. An amusement park!!!!! I immediately jumped out of the car to get a closer look, but my view was soon blocked by tears. Suddenly, a hand was wrapped around my shoulders. 

“Are you alright?” James, of course. 

Another arm was wrapped around my shoulders from the other side. 

“Honey, what’s wrong?” Tessa. 

I quickly wiped my tears away with the back of my sleeve. 

“I’m fine. It’s just, I haven’t been to an amusement park in years.” 

They didn’t say anything, but they both laughed before Michael and Steve joined us. What took them so long? 

I was steered forward by the arms around me, but I didn't need more than that before I was taking off to go get in line. Behind me, I heard Tessa yell my name and tell me to wait. It was followed by three deeps laughs and the sound of running. Seconds later I was joined by the three guys in line. Looking back I saw Tessa still a good distance away shaking her head and laughing. When she caught up to us she sighed. 

“You guys do know that I’m the one with the tickets right?” Simultaneously all three of the guys were blushing. 

“Sorry…” Steve said. 

“We saw Sera take off and…” Michael added. 

“We got excited…” James finished. 

“Children… you’re all children.” Tessa sighed. 

Once we made it past the gates and into the park I took off again, running towards the first ride I saw to get in line. It was a type of water ride called the Coal Cracker. It looked like a roller coaster but the cart was like a boat and the track was water. We only had to wait in line for a couple of minutes. I must not have been a very popular ride. I hopped into the boat first and James sat behind me, Michael behind him. Steve and Tessa were forced to get into the next one. The ride had two large drops and we got splashed with water both times, but we were far from soaked. The rest was just like being on a regular river. 

After getting off, we waited for Steve and Tessa before I rushed off to the next thing I saw. It was a wooden roller coaster called Comet. I sat with Tessa, and because the guy’s legs were so long they all had to get their own carts. The ride was thrilling, but definitely not as thrilling as the ones that would be coming up. 

We got on several more roller coasters, the wait of which was ridiculous, but this park seemed to be known for them. Each time we got off to look at the pictures and they didn’t disappoint. We had come to figure out that Steve wasn’t too fond of roller coasters and every picture he looked so scared. Everyone else looked like they were really enjoying it.
